titleOfInvention |
Compositions and methods for producing tobacco plants and products having reduced or eliminated suckers |
abstract |
The present disclosure provides the identification of genes involved in sucker growth in tobacco. Also provided are promoters that are preferentially active in tobacco axillary buds. Also provided are modified tobacco plants comprising reduced or no sucker growth. Also provided are methods and compositions for producing modified tobacco plants comprising reduced or no sucker growth. |
